HISTORY

The Campbell clan goes back to 1260 with the earliest known Campbell, Gillaesbaig of Menstrie, father of Cailean Mor ( Great Colin) who was knighted and established at Loch Awe in 1280. The first Inveraray Castle, the seat of the Campbell clan,  was built in 1457.
The Campbell tartan contains a rich fine blend of green with blue and black and a red stripe.

Crest:A Boars Head.
Motto: Ne Obliviscaris (Forget Not)
Seat: Inveraray Castle, Argyll
Chief: Torquil Campbell, 13th Duke of Argyll

ABOUT THE CARPET

Materials: All of our carpets are 80% British Wool and 20% Nylon. Woven 8 row Axminster with a heavy commercial quality.
